2 of the biggest French-speaking Mastodon sites had blocked me. Their users, even those who followed me or whom I followed, could not interact with me or see my messages.
And I must stress one point: there had been NO information about these blockages, or more exactly these "suspensions". I was not aware of it. And neither were the users of the 2 big authorities that had done this.
@BeAware And, in fact, this instance welcomed a lot of users when the media started talking about Mastodon, around 2017. As a result, it's one of the biggest French-language forums.
And as a result, those who are blocked are cut off from a large proportion of Mastodon's French-speaking users...
